Frequently Asked Questions

What is the population and demographic makeup of Columbus?

The total population of Columbus is approximately 679. The community has a large population of young adults (18-34). This demographic data is sourced from the U.S. Census Bureau.

Is Columbus walkable and transit-friendly?

Based on local geographic data, Columbus has an amenity and walkability score of 41/100 and a transit score of 28/100. This indicates moderate access to local amenities and transportation.

Do more people rent or own homes in Columbus?

The housing market in Columbus is predominantly driven by homeowners, with 91% of housing units being owner-occupied and 9% being renter-occupied.

What is the education level of residents in Columbus?

In Columbus, approximately 15% of adult residents hold a bachelor's degree or higher. Additionally, 9% of the population holds a master's degree or higher. This indicates the local educational attainment compared to state and national averages.
